Common Air Conditioner Problems We Solve

Your air conditioning system is complex, and a single symptom can point to a variety of underlying issues. Our experienced technicians are trained to identify the root cause of the problem, ensuring we perform the right repair the first time. We frequently handle a wide range of AC failures for homeowners in Sappington.

AC Not Cooling or Blowing Warm Air

This is the most common complaint and can be caused by several factors. It could be a simple issue like a clogged air filter restricting airflow, or something more serious, such as low refrigerant levels due to a leak or a failing compressor.

Unusual Noises During Operation

Your AC should operate with a consistent, low hum. If you hear new or loud noises, it’s a clear sign of trouble.

  1. Grinding or Squealing: Often indicates a problem with the motor bearings in the indoor blower or outdoor condenser fan.
  2. Hissing: A classic sign of a refrigerant leak, which requires immediate professional attention.
  3. Banging or Clanking: This may signal a loose or broken part, such as a piston, connecting rod, or crankshaft within the compressor.

Water Leaks Around the Unit

If you notice water pooling around your indoor air handler, it's typically caused by a clogged condensate drain line. This line is responsible for removing moisture from the air, and a blockage can lead to water backup, property damage, and mold growth.

AC Cycles On and Off Frequently (Short Cycling)

An air conditioner that turns on and off every few minutes is not cooling your home efficiently and is under severe strain. This can be caused by an oversized unit, a malfunctioning thermostat, or low refrigerant levels.

Weak Airflow from Vents

If the air coming from your vents feels weak, it can be due to a clogged air filter, blocked ductwork, or a failing blower motor. This reduces cooling effectiveness and forces your system to work harder, increasing energy consumption.

Refrigerant Leak Detection and Repair

Refrigerant is the lifeblood of your AC system. A leak not only prevents your unit from cooling but is also harmful to the environment. We use electronic leak detectors and other advanced methods to precisely locate the source of the leak, repair the damaged component, and safely recharge your system to the manufacturer’s specifications.

Making the Right Choice: Repair vs. Replacement

A common question we hear from Sappington homeowners is whether it’s better to repair an old air conditioner or invest in a new one. The answer depends on several factors, including the age of your unit, the cost of the repair, and your system’s overall efficiency.

A helpful guideline is the "$5000 Rule." Multiply the age of your AC unit by the estimated cost of the repair. If the total is more than $5,000, replacement is often the more cost-effective option in the long run.

Consider repairing your AC if:

  1. The unit is less than 10 years old.
  2. The needed repair is minor and costs significantly less than a new system.
  3. The unit has been reliable and well-maintained.

Consider replacing your AC if:

  1. The unit is over 12-15 years old.
  2. It requires frequent and increasingly expensive repairs.
  3. Your energy bills have been steadily rising.
  4. The system uses the outdated R-22 refrigerant, which is being phased out.
